Abstract
The invention provides a monocomponent polyurethane foaming type adhesive, which is prepared by adding, according to the finished product containing 5 to 20% of isocyanate group, polymerized MDI, MDI0129M, polyether polyalcohol, plasticizer, color paste and dimorpholinyl diethylether into a reaction kettle, heating and reacting at the temperature of 60 to 90 DEG C for 60 to 150 minutes. The adhesive has no organic solvent, after being solidified, the adhesive is formed into a micro foam layer with good mechanical strength.
Description
Technical field
The present invention relates to a kind of monocomponent polyurethane foaming type adhesive.
Technical background
The requirement that production efficiency is improved along with society, and people are to the light-weighted pursuit of material, the method for bond materials such as nail that tradition wastes time and energy or anchoring is replaced by the bonding method of tackiness agent more and more.Polyurethane tackifier owing to have active isocyanate groups on the molecular chain, has good bonding force to conventional materials such as timber, cement and metals, has obtained to use widely and significant progress at building material industry.Polyurethane adhesive generally is divided into two-pack and monocomponent adhesive, and monocomponent polyurethane adhesive comparison bi-component polyurethane adhesive has significantly advantage easy to use.Monocomponent polyurethane adhesive traditionally generally uses TDI (tolylene diisocyanate), and higher vapour pressure and the toxicity of TDI has limited its application.The tradition monocomponent polyurethane adhesive generally all needs to add organic solvent, and well-known, these solvents are pollutents of environment.
Summary of the invention
The objective of the invention is to overcome the deficiencies in the prior art, propose a kind of not solvent-laden monocomponent polyurethane foaming type adhesive.The technical scheme that the present invention takes is: the isocyanic ester in the adhesive components all uses MDI (diphenylmethanediisocyanate), wherein MDI at least 50% is an isomer 2,4MDI content is about 50% MDI, as the Desmodur 0129M of German Bayer company.
Technological process of the present invention is such: add polyvalent alcohol, auxiliary agent and MDI isocyanic ester in reactor, chemical reaction is carried out in intensification, temperature of reaction is between 60 ℃~90 ℃, and the reaction times obtained monocomponent polyurethane foaming type adhesive between 60 minutes~150 minutes.The curing of monocomponent polyurethane foaming type adhesive is undertaken by the chemical reaction of isocyanic ester and water, and water can be airborne moisture, also can be the water that material surface adsorbs.The chemical reaction of isocyanic ester and water produces carbonic acid gas, and carbonic acid gas forms micropore in tackiness agent, thereby forms the bonding interface of little foaming.
In the present invention, Desmodur 0129M or other isomer 2,4MDI content are about 50% MDI, and its consumption is at least 50% of the total consumption of MDI.Other spendable MDI comprises: polymeric MDI, and liquefaction modification MDI, mixed and modified MDI, the consumption of this type of MDI is less than 50% of the total consumption of MDI.
In the present invention, the polyvalent alcohol of use comprises: molecular weight is between 100~6000 polyether Glycols or trivalent alcohol, and molecular weight is between 500~3000 polyester diol or trivalent alcohol, natural polyvalent alcohol such as castor-oil plant wet goods.Polyvalent alcohol can use separately, also can be the mixture of different polyvalent alcohols.
In the present invention, the isocyanate group mass contg of the finished product is between 5%~20%.
In the present invention, used auxiliary agent comprises: softening agent, and as DOP, clorafin etc.; Tinting material is as phthalocyanine blue etc.; Catalyzer is as N,N-Dibenzylamine etc.; Anti-aging agent such as BHT etc.Total consumption of this analog assistant is less than 50% of tackiness agent total amount.

Embodiment
Embodiment 1
In a glass reaction flask of having equipped stirring, thermopair, add Desmodur0129M (German Bayer company) 500 grams, polyether glycol GMN-3050 (Shanghai Gaoqiao petrochemical industry) 100 grams, polyether glycol GE-204 (Shanghai Gaoqiao petrochemical industry) 80 grams, N,N-Dibenzylamine 5.0 grams, phthalocyanine blue mill base 6.0 grams.Chemical reaction is carried out in intensification, and 60 ℃ of temperature of reaction in 150 minutes reaction times, obtain monocomponent polyurethane foaming type adhesive.After testing, isocyanate group mass contg 20.0%, viscosity is 600mPa.s/25 ℃.Tackiness agent surface drying time 30 minutes, the density after the curing are 100kg/m
3Steel plate galvanized-cementitious intensity is greater than 5Mpa.
Embodiment 2
In a glass reaction flask of having equipped stirring, thermopair, add Desmodur0129M (German Bayer company) 250 grams, polymeric MDI 44V20 (German Bayer company) 250 grams, polyether glycol GE-220 (Shanghai Gaoqiao petrochemical industry) 900 grams, polyether glycol GE-204 (Shanghai Gaoqiao petrochemical industry) 50 grams, N,N-Dibenzylamine 0.2 gram, clorafin 52#600 gram, antideteriorant BHT 10 grams.Chemical reaction is carried out in intensification, and 90 ℃ of temperature of reaction in 60 minutes reaction times, obtain monocomponent polyurethane foaming type adhesive.After testing, isocyanate group mass contg 5%, viscosity is 8000mPa.s/25 ℃.Tackiness agent surface drying time 20 minutes, the density behind the adhesive solidification are 800kg/m
3The plank bonding strength is greater than 6Mpa.
